Pawsitive Hearts is a 501c3 foster-based dog rescue. We operate within a 1-hour radius of both Zanesville and Columbus, Ohio. Our mission is to prevent euthanasia and save the lives of as many dogs as we can by removing them from overcrowded shelters. This 5k race is one of our annual fundraisers that allow us to provide spay/neuter surgeries, vaccines, emergency surgeries, and all needed foster supplies for all of our dogs at no cost to the foster.
